Beltane Drive, London SW19

New build detached house designed by architect Tim Gledstone of Squire & Partners.

A deceptively complex design with gull wing roof and a triple height space at the rear of the building. The large glazed areas at the back combined with the lack of supporting floors meant that two steel ‘goal posts’ had to be introduced to provide stability. This lead to a complex sequence in the build to achieve the required airtightness. To assist, a whole sequence of 3D drawings were provided to guide the build step by step.

The house has been designed to meet the Passivhaus Plus standard though has not been certified. Currently generating more electricity that is consumed.

Passivhaus and Carbon/Energy statistics:

TFA: 370 m².
Building Form Factor: 2.7 with average wall U-value 0.101 W/m²K, floor 0.088 W/m²K,  roof 0.096 W/m²K and average installed whole window/door U values 0.92 W/m²K.
Overheating percentage: 0% – summer cooling provided via Zehnder Comfocool.
Heating Demand: 8.90 kWh/m².yr.
Heating load: 7.47 W/m².
AC/hr @ 50 Pa: 0.28
Renewable energy demand: 30 kWh/m²a.
Embodied Carbon PH15 System inc foundations: A1-A3 106.6 tonnes
Meets RIBA 2030 target for Operational Energy and Embodied Carbon.
Construction by: Beltane Construction Ltd.
Completed: Spring 2021

Buildoffsite Property Assurance Scheme (BOPAS) was developed to address the concerns and perceived risks associated with innovative construction. BOPAS is recognised by the principal mortgage lenders as providing the necessary assurance underpinned by a warranty provision, that the property will be readily mortgageable for at least 60 years.
